Leah Messer may have had a change of heart about her future on "Teen Mom 2". After announcing on Twitter on November 20 that she quit the MTV reality series, she is now reported to have signed up to return for the upcoming season 6.
The mother of three previously told fans, "I'm sorry," when asked if she would return for the sixth season of the hit series. According to Us Weekly, Leah didn't "want her drama on TV anymore," and she was "scarred by how her split with Corey [Simms] played out on TV."
Leah married Corey, who is the father of her twin daughters Ali and Aleeah, in 2009. They divorced in 2011 after Corey found out that Leah cheated on him with her ex-boyfriend. The exes have a turbulent relationship following their split.
Leah later married Jeremy Calvert on April 4, 2012. They have a child together, a girl named Adalynn Faith Calvert who was born on February 4, 2013. Calvert recently accused Leah of cheating, but a source says, "Jeremy and Leah are still together. He's not checked out of their marriage."
